uPVC Door Handles
There are a variety of uPVC handles that are available with some that are more suitable for specific doors than others. Some are specifically designed to be more focused on security, while others are primarily for aesthetic purposes. For instance, certain uPVC handles are made from harder materials like stainless steel which can offer more strength and security. However, others are made from plastics like ABS and uPVC which are less likely to be damaged in the case of a bump or a knock.
It is essential to consider the screw center measurement and the PZ dimension, when choosing the new handle as well as the length of the backplate. This will ensure that the replacement upvc door handle repairs handles fit correctly and work seamlessly with the lock mechanism of the door.
The most commonly used uPVC handle is the lever/lever design which includes two levers inline on either side. The spindle is connected to the handle through the door. It can be used to open or close the door. Another popular kind of uPVC handle is the pad arrangement, which consists of one lever and a movable pad handle. They are typically fitted to internal doors such as french doors and patio doors to stop people from accessing the door from the outside without the key.
Some uPVC door handles have a snib handle which can be turned on to secure the latch providing an additional level of security. This can be particularly useful when you have children living in your home who may be enticed to play with the latch and let themselves out.
If your double-glazed door is difficult to open, or the handle is drooping it is not an issue with the handle. Instead the worn-out springs inside the lock case could be the cause. A professional locksmith can inspect the issue and recommend an appropriate solution.

There are two kinds of backing that can be found on a lever-on rose door handle such as backplates and roses. Roses are circular and cover a tiny portion of the handle. Backplates are rectangular and are more traditional in appearance. If you choose to purchase a lever-on-rose set of door handles that will typically come with both methods of fixing - bolt through and face fixing. Both are simple to use, but the bolt-through method is recommended as it allows for a more secure connection, while minimizing damage to the door.
Once you've decided on your lever-on rose door handles, take the existing escutcheons from your doors. Then, drill 5mm holes into each of the corners of the door on which you intend to put the handles. Place the roses on top of the holes and screw them in place with the provided screws. The grub screw on each lever must be aligned with the hole on the shank of the lever before tightening. After you have tightened all bolts evenly ensure that your levers are free to move and that all components are fitted securely.

Lever pad door handles are a great choice for those looking to improve the look of their door. They are designed to work with split spindle locks, and have a lever either side of the door. Each lever operates independently with offset spindles. This design permits greater ergonomic use and stops the latch from being pulled from outside, meaning that only a key could be used to open the door (unless it is deadlocked).
Door handles made of uPVC come in a variety of finishes and shapes and are often made of either zinc alloy or die-cast aluminum. This means that they are hard-wearing and can endure the elements. It is important to measure three things before purchasing a new door handle to ensure that the new handles fit correctly. The first measurement you should take is the PZ. This measures the distance between the screw fixing points on the backplate of the door handle. The second is the thickness of the handle and the third is the centre hole measurement of the multipoint lock that will be fitted to the door.
